Jace – Midas (ft. Robb Banks)

by .

PRODUCER: JGramm
UPCOMING PROJECT: Jace Tape
RELEASE DATE: February 29th

Two of the south’s premiere lyrical assassins and taste-makers link up for a combo meal on Jace Tape called “Midas”. Jace, more known from his duo Retro Su$h! and collective Two9, has been building heavy anticipation for his solo project slated to drop on leap day. The aura of the project has been magnified after Jace called for a X-Men scale studio meet up in Los Angeles this past  weekend, where he invited any and every elitist in the underground to pull up and get active in the booth. To no surprise, Florida’s very own Robb Bank$ answered the invite in quick fashion and the two gave us a banger just as sudden. A heavy, bounce filled beat produced by JGramm, Jace and Robb go back to back with the quotable bars, giving us something to fiend for before this upcoming Monday when Jace Tape is finally released to the public. Expect damage.

Tyla Yaweh – Views (Video)

DIRECTOR: ByHype

Coming off the momentum of his first headlining show at Backbooth in Orlando, Tyla Yaweh drops a visual for his latest track “Views.” The Swamp Posse artist sticks to his roots in this visual as he perpetuates the smooth melodic vibes prominent in his signature EP 4:44 A.M. This visual offers a winning combination of dreamy production work paired with personal insight as the Orlando artists dives into the success that comes with relying on oneself and trusting a seldom few. With the highly anticipated “4:44 A.M.” visual said to be completed, “Views” creates anticipation for what the Orlando artist has in store. Expect good vibes listening to this one.
